Skip to main content
Astra Automation
본 한국어 번역은 사용자 편의를 위해 제공되는 기계 번역입니다. 영어 버전과 한국어 버전이 서로 어긋나는 경우에는 언제나 영어 버전이 우선합니다.

앱을 관리합니다

기여자 dmp-netapp netapp-aoife

특정 네임스페이스에서 이미 Astra에 알려진 응용 프로그램을 기반으로 관리되는 응용 프로그램을 만들 수 있습니다. 애플리케이션이 Astra에 관리 또는 정의되면 백업 및 스냅샷을 생성하여 보호할 수 있습니다.

단계 1: 네임스페이스를 선택합니다

워크플로우를 수행합니다 "네임스페이스를 나열합니다" 이름 공간을 선택합니다.

2단계: 클러스터를 선택합니다

워크플로우를 수행합니다 "클러스터 나열" 클러스터를 선택합니다.

단계 3: 응용 프로그램을 관리합니다

다음 REST API 호출을 수행하여 애플리케이션을 관리합니다.

HTTP 메서드 및 끝점입니다

이 REST API 호출은 다음과 같은 메소드와 엔드포인트를 사용합니다.

HTTP 메소드 경로

게시

/accounts/{account_id}/k8s/v2/apps

추가 입력 매개변수

모든 REST API 호출에서 일반적으로 사용되는 매개 변수 외에도 이 단계의 curl 예제에도 다음 매개 변수가 사용됩니다.

매개 변수 유형 필수 요소입니다 설명

JSON을 참조하십시오

바디

관리할 응용 프로그램을 식별하는 데 필요한 매개 변수를 제공합니다. 아래 예를 참조하십시오.

CURL 예: 앱 관리
curl --request POST \
--location "https://astra.netapp.io/accounts/$ACCOUNT_ID/k8s/v2/apps" \
--include \
--header "Content-Type: application/astra-app+json" \
--header "Accept: */*" \
--header "Authorization: Bearer $API_TOKEN" \
--data @JSONinput
JSON 입력 예
{
  "clusterID": "7ce83fba-6aa1-4e0c-a194-26e714f5eb46",
  "name": "subtext",
  "namespaceScopedResources": [{"namespace": "kube-matrix"}],
  "type": "application/astra-app",
  "version": "2.0"
}